MSH

でオブジェクト指向

MSH

テトリス作ったとき*1にかなり試行錯誤し、このコーディングスタイルが正しいのか不安であったけど、Web ChangeLog*2さんも同じようなスタイルになっている。ちょっと安心。 そのうちクラスが導入されることを願っております。 *1:テトリス - へたっぴ日記 *…

テトリス

とりあえずなんか作ろう、ということで判定ルーチンなど特に考えなくてよさげのテトリスにしてみた。 特に実用しようとは考えていなかったので効率無視のコーディングをしていたけど、あまりにも描画が遅い。Refresh()でPaintイベントが発生してから描画して…

イベントハンドラデリゲートの引数

MSHにてKeyPressイベント発生時の押下された文字を取得する方法に悩むこと数十分。 (C#) public delegate void KeyPressEventHandler(object sender, KeyPressEventArgs e);予想外に$_にKeyPressEventArgsオブジェクトが入っていた。$argsとかparam()あたり…

クラスないの?

Windows VistaにMonadが搭載されない*1というので安心して放置してたんだけど、知らない間にβ3*2まできてしまったのでちょっと遊んでおくことにした。id:newpopsさんのところに日本語での解説が多くあり非常に助かります。ところでクラスの定義はできないん…